VITRUVIUS POLLIO, Marcus. Les Dix Livres d'Architecture, edited and translated by Claude Perrault, Paris: J.-B. Coignard, 1684. 2°, engraved frontispiece, title, plates and plans, contemporary calf (joints split, rubbed).

Second edition of Perrault's translation, containing an additional plate which influenced Nicholas Hawksmoor's design for the arcaded roofwork at Blenheim Palace. Berlin Cat. 1818; Brunet V 1130; Cicognara 730.
